What is Visa Sponsorship in Singapore?
Visa sponsorship means:
- A Singapore-based employer offers you a job
- The employer applies for your work pass
- You are legally allowed to work and stay in Singapore
Common work passes include:
- Work Permit (for semi-skilled and unskilled workers)
- S Pass (for mid-skilled workers)
- Employment Pass (for skilled professionals)
Top Visa Sponsorship Jobs in Singapore (2026)
1. Construction Workers
Construction remains one of the biggest employers of foreign workers.
Responsibilities:
- Site labor and manual work
- Assisting skilled trades
- Material handling and cleanup
Average Salary: SGD $1,800 – $3,000/month

2. Manufacturing and Factory Workers
Singapore’s industrial sector continues to expand.
Responsibilities:
- Operating machinery
- Assembly line production
- Packaging and quality control
Average Salary: SGD $1,700 – $2,800/month
3. Warehouse and Logistics Jobs
E-commerce growth is driving demand in logistics.
Responsibilities:
- Sorting and packing goods
- Inventory management
- Loading and unloading shipments
Average Salary: SGD $1,800 – $2,900/month
4. Cleaning and Maintenance Jobs
Cleaning services are essential across commercial and residential sectors.
Responsibilities:
- Cleaning offices, malls, and hotels
- Waste management
- Maintaining hygiene standards
Average Salary: SGD $1,600 – $2,400/month
5. Hospitality and Food Service Jobs
Tourism and food industries continue to hire foreign workers.
Roles include:
- Kitchen assistants
- Hotel housekeeping staff
- Waiters and service crew
Average Salary: SGD $1,700 – $2,600/month
Visa Sponsorship Process in Singapore
To work legally in Singapore, the process typically includes:
- Receiving a job offer from a Singapore employer
- Employer applies for a Work Permit or relevant pass
- Approval from the Ministry of Manpower (MOM)
- Issuance of work visa and relocation
Employers usually handle most of the application process.
Requirements for Foreign Workers in Singapore
To qualify for visa sponsorship jobs, you typically need:
- Valid international passport
- Job offer from a Singapore employer
- Basic English communication skills
- Good physical health
- Clean criminal record
Additional requirements may include:
- Relevant experience for certain roles
- Medical examination approval
